Introduction:

In today's fast-paced world, the original 9-5 time-table no more pertains to numerous households. One of several key great things about 24-hour daycare could be the freedom it provides working parents. Numerous parents work changes that stretch beyond standard daycare hours, which makes it difficult to acquire childcare that meets their particular rout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this problem by giving attention during evenings, vacations, plus immediately. This permits parents to your workplace without fretting about finding you to definitely view kids during non-traditional hours.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are could be the peace of mind it gives to parents. Knowing that kids are increasingly being taken care of by trained specialists in a secure and protected environment can alleviate the tension and guilt that often includes making young ones in daycare. Parents can concentrate on their work realizing that kids are in good arms, which could result in increased output and task satisfaction.

Also, 24-hour daycare centers can offer a sense of neighborhood and assistance for people. Parents who work non-traditional hours usually battle to find childcare options that satisfy their demands, causing feelings of isolation and tension. 24-hour daycare centers can provide a sense of belonging and camaraderie among parents facing similar challenges, producing a support system that can help households th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ide benefits, in addition they incorporate their own set of difficulties. One of the biggest difficulties is staffing. Finding skilled and dependable childcare providers who're ready to work non-traditional hours could be difficult, leading to large return prices and prospective staffing shortages. This could impact the standard of attention provided to young ones and produce uncertainty for households depending on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the price. Offering attention around-the-clock requires additional staffing and sources, which could drive within the price of solutions. This is a barrier for low-income households whom might not be able to pay for 24-hour daycare, making these with limited choices for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To ensure the protection and well being of kiddies in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and oversight are crucial. State and neighborhood governments put requirements for certification and accreditation of daycare centers, including the ones that function around the clock. These standards c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ety requirements, and staff instruction and qualifications.

And federal government laws, many 24-hour daycare centers decide to look for certification from national businesses including the nationwide Association for Education of children (NAEYC) or the nationwide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a commitment to high-quality treatment and that can help moms and dads feel confident inside their range of childcare provider.

Summary:

The increase of 24-hour daycare facilities reflects the changing requirements and needs of contemporary families. By offering versatile care choices, satisfaction for moms and dads, and a feeling of community and help, 24-hour daycare centers perform a vital role in aiding people balance work and family obligations. While difficulties like staffing and value stay, regulation and supervision are crucial to making sure the safety and wellbeing of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ities. Given that need for non-traditional childcare options is growing, 24-hour daycare facilities will play an extremely crucial role in supporting working households when you look at the years into the future.
